Danish Ambassador Peter Lysholt Hansen at the official opening of Yasaka-Saigon-Nha Trang International Tourism Vocational Center’s practice facility on Monday

Danish Ambassador Peter Lysholt Hansen attended the opening of a Danish-sponsored practice facility at a vocational school in Nha Trang on Monday.

The Scandinavian nation donated VND4 billion (US$225,060), which was 70 percent of the money spent on equipment for the facility at the Yasaka-Saigon-Nha Trang International Tourism Vocational Center.

The Yasaka-Saigon-Nhatrang Beach Resort Hotel contributed the rest.

Since it was established two years ago, the school in the central beach town has trained some 1,000 young people to work in hospitality and tourism.
